Nancy Guthrie update: Authorities release images of 'armed individual' from surveillance footage
"Authorities investigating the mysterious disappearance of "Today" show host Savannah Guthrie's mother, Nancy Guthrie, have released surveillance images of a person of interest in the case. The photos, released to the public by the FBI on Tuesday, shows a masked person captured on the Nest doorbell camera on Nancy Guthrie's home. Up until this point, law enforcement officials have not identified any persons of interest or suspects in the case."
"Authorities believe 84-year-old Nancy Guthrie was taken from her Arizona home against her will 10 days ago. The elderly woman, who has limited mobility, a pacemaker, and depends on daily medication for a heart condition, was reported missing by her family on February 1 after she was last seen the night before when they dropped her off at home following a dinner."
"Pima County Sheriff Chris Nanos has said that Nancy Guthrie's doorbell camera had been removed and that blood discovered on her porch matched back to her. The case has captured national attention amid reports of purported ransom notes and emotional video pleas by Savannah Guthrie and her siblings. On Monday, the famed NBC anchor posted a new Instagram video, telling her nearly two million followers: "We are at an hour of desperation, and we need your help.""
